Understanding the Sam’s Club Decoration Recall
The recalled product is the Member’s Mark 7′ Pre-Lit Twinkling Buck, a large outdoor reindeer figure adorned with warm white LED lights. It stands about seven feet tall and features a big bow around its neck for that festive touch. Many shoppers loved its twinkling effect and sturdy build, making it a standout piece for front yards.
Seasonal Specialties, the importer based in Minnesota, issued the recall in coordination with the U.S. Consumer Product Safety Commission (CPSC). The problem occurs if the internal wires get connected the wrong way during assembly. This can lead to the current-limiting resistor overheating, raising the chance of burns or even a fire.
While only a small number of units were sold, the potential hazard makes this recall important for anyone who bought holiday decorations from Sam’s Club last year.
Key Product Details and How to Identify It
Here is what makes this specific decoration stand out, and how you can confirm if yours is part of the recall:
- Item Name: Member’s Mark 7-Foot Pre-Lit Twinkling Buck
- Model Number: 990404199 (check the cord tag near the wall plug)
- Sold At: Sam’s Club online (SamsClub.com)
- Dates Sold: August 2025 through December 2025
- Price: Around $170
- Features: 1,608 warm white LED lights, twinkling or steady modes, chasing lights on the bow and antlers
If your reindeer matches this description and has the listed model number, it is affected. The recall does not involve in-store purchases or other similar items.
Why Was the Sam’s Club Reindeer Recalled?
Assembly instructions play a big role here. The buck comes in sections, and connecting the wires incorrectly can bypass safety features. Five reports reached the company about smoky or overheating units, which prompted quick action.
This is not the first time holiday lights and decorations have faced scrutiny. Overheating components in outdoor decor remain a common issue, especially with larger pre-lit figures that draw more power. The good news is that Seasonal Specialties acted fast once they identified the problem.
What Should You Do Right Now?
Stop using the decoration immediately. Unplug it and keep it away from your home until you resolve the issue. Do not try to fix the wiring yourself, as that could worsen the problem or void any remedy options.
You have two choices for resolution:
- A full refund of approximately $170
- A free repair kit that includes color-coded wire labels, a warning sticker, and clear instructions
Most people find the repair kit straightforward if they feel comfortable handling the fix. Others prefer the hassle-free refund route.
Step-by-Step Guide to Claim Your Refund or Repair Kit
Getting help is easier than you might think. Follow these steps:
- Gather your model number, proof of purchase if possible, and contact details.
- Reach out to Seasonal Specialties directly. Call them at 800-353-3116 or email buckrecall@seasonalspecialties.com.
- Explain that you own the recalled Twinkling Buck and state whether you want the refund or repair kit.
- Provide shipping information for the kit or details for the refund process.
- For in-person help, visit your local Sam’s Club. Associates can guide you on returns or next steps.
The company handles these requests promptly, so you should not face long delays. Keep records of all communications just in case.
Safety Tips for Holiday Decorations Moving Forward
This recall highlights why checking product safety matters every season. Here are some practical tips to protect your family and home:
- Always follow assembly instructions exactly, especially for wiring.
- Use outdoor-rated extension cords and avoid overloading circuits.
- Inspect lights and decorations for damage before each use.
- Consider smart plugs or timers to reduce fire risks.
- Buy from reputable brands that meet current safety standards.
Taking a few extra minutes during setup can prevent headaches later. Many families now photograph their setups for records too.
